Instructions to make Just made some Cornish pasties. Delicious!:

  1. Peel the swede, onions and potatoes.
  2. Chop all finely.
  3. Cook onions in a little oil for 2mins, add the mince and stir until brown then add the other vegatables and cook for 4-5mins. Allow it all to cool.
  4. Depending on how many you want to make, cut your pastry into slices, do each pasty one by one..
  5. Role out your sectioned pastry into a nice circle, then add the filling is a straight line in the middle. Bring both sides together and pinch, after that pinch the ends. HOWEVER, DO NOT FOLD..
  6. Before cooking, cover in beaten egg..
  7. After that, cook for approx.10mins.
